如何诊断与优化速度缓慢的VPN连接?网络工程师的实战指南
在当今远程办公、跨境访问和数据安全日益重要的背景下,虚拟私人网络(VPN)已成为个人用户和企业不可或缺的工具,许多用户常常遇到一个令人困扰的问题:连接速度异常缓慢,这不仅影响工作效率,还可能让用户误以为是网络基础设施的问题,作为网络工程师,我将从技术角度出发,系统分析导致VPN速度慢的原因,并提供切实可行的优化方案。
明确“速度慢”的定义至关重要,它可能表现为网页加载延迟、视频卡顿、文件传输缓慢或端到端Ping值高,这些现象背后,往往隐藏着多种潜在问题,我们需按优先级逐层排查:
-
本地网络环境
检查本地Wi-Fi或有线连接是否稳定,使用ping命令测试到网关和DNS服务器的延迟,如果本地延迟已超过50ms,说明问题不在VPN本身,而是路由器、ISP或设备性能所致,建议重启路由器、更换信道(尤其在2.4GHz频段拥挤时),并确保设备未被恶意软件占用带宽。 -
VPN协议与加密强度
不同协议对性能影响显著,OpenVPN默认使用AES-256加密,虽安全但CPU开销大;而WireGuard采用现代加密算法,在同等安全性下延迟更低、吞吐量更高,若你使用的是老旧协议(如PPTP或L2TP/IPsec),建议升级至IKEv2或WireGuard,检查是否启用了不必要的功能(如DNS泄漏保护或杀毒模块),这些会增加额外处理时间。 -
服务器负载与地理位置
远程VPN服务器若处于高负载状态(CPU利用率>80%),响应自然变慢,选择离你物理位置近的服务器节点可减少网络跳数,降低延迟,中国用户访问美国服务器时,通常需经过多个中转节点,RTT(往返时延)可达100-300ms,可通过traceroute命令查看路径,并对比不同服务商的节点表现。 -
MTU设置不当
一些运营商或防火墙会限制最大传输单元(MTU),若MTU配置错误,会导致分片丢失或重传,引发严重拥塞,标准MTU为1500字节,但在某些PPPoE环境下可能需设为1492,可用工具如ping -f -l 1472命令测试丢包情况,逐步调整直至无分片产生。 -
QoS策略与带宽限制
若你在公司或家庭网络中使用了QoS(服务质量)策略,可能因优先级设置不合理,导致VPN流量被限速,检查路由器管理界面中的流量控制规则,确保非关键应用(如下载、流媒体)不会抢占VPN通道带宽。
推荐一套完整的排查流程:
① 使用speedtest.net测量本地带宽;
② 启用VPN后再次测速,对比差异;
③ 用mtr(Windows下为tracert + ping组合)追踪路由;
④ 更换协议/服务器节点进行A/B测试。
速度慢的VPN并非无解难题,通过系统性诊断,结合本地优化与服务端配置调整,绝大多数情况下都能实现流畅体验,作为网络工程师,我们不仅要解决当下问题,更要帮助用户建立长期的网络健康意识——毕竟,稳定的连接才是数字世界的基石。


















